Highlights
Are people in Tiki Island older or younger than people in Cleghorn?
- The Median Age in Tiki Island is 8.0 years older than in Cleghorn.
Are housing costs cheaper in Tiki Island or Cleghorn?
- Tiki Island
housing
costs are 336.1% more expensive than Cleghorn hous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Tiki Island or Cleghorn?
- The average commute for residents of Tiki Island is 25.3 minutes longer than it is for residents of Cleghorn.

Things to do in Tiki Island?
Tiki Island, TX is a quaint coastal community located on the southern shore of Galveston Bay. With its tropical climate and stunning views, it's the perfect place to relax and unwind. Residents enjoy a relaxed lifestyle with plenty of outdoor activities like fishing, boating, swimming, and beachcombing. The town has an eclectic mix of restaurants, shops and entertainment venues that provide something for everyone. The local marina provides access to nearby islands and areas of natural beauty. With its friendly people and laid-back atmosphere, Tiki Island offers a unique experience for those looking for a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of city life.
